Have you tried replacing the firewire lead? And also make sure all leads are firmly connected and have some slack.

In SCS I suggest you go to General Options / Permanent Options / Audio Driver, and clear the checkbox marked Use Software Mixer instead of Hardware Mixer. Then click the OK button and close and restart SCS. This may not make any difference, but this checkbox should normally be cleared for all but the most basic sound cards.

Regarding the video / still image subject, videos are played using an API into Windows Media Player (WMP) whereas still images are displayed directly by SCS. So it's understandable that an error in displaying videos does not affect still images. What error are you getting with the first video cue?

With conclusion to this post, I was indeed using the internal mixer which I think was the main cause of the problem. I am currently using the Saffire LE again, with the newer drivers (1.5) and 10.7.2 without the internal mixer and currently have no issues! So I can only blame my poor programming/knowlegde of SCS for the intermittent fuzzing and other problems. Apologies for not being able to provide any more help. Just ensure your drivers are up to date with regards to SCS not showing all the outputs.
